Peter Andrews

Mr. Andrews brings extensive experience driving top and bottom line performance improvement and transformations, improving shareholder and overall enterprise value. He is relentless in optimizing operations and service delivery in corporate transformations and merger integrations, drastically reducing costs while improving end to end customer experience. Adept in both B2B and B2C environments, he drives growth and efficiency through sales effectiveness, process improvement, business process outsourcing and post-merger integration.
Mr. Andrews’ notable achievements include multiple large corporate merger integrations; tuck-in acquisitions in the commercial services space; and a carve-out and divestiture of a large European operation for an industrial. He also led multiple enterprise level transformations, implementing structural change to improve profitability, restore growth and drive sustainable improvements in culture and capabilities.
Prior to joining A&M, Mr. Andrews led commercial and customer operations as SVP of Global Lodging Operations at Expedia. Earlier, he led operations in the services business unit of Lennox International, as well as the company’s M&A and strategy efforts.
Previously, Mr. Andrews served as an Engagement Manager at McKinsey and Company, where he consulted across various industries, including transportation and logistics, CPG, energy, travel and hospitality and industrials. He began his career as a nuclear submarine officer in the U.S. Navy.
Mr. Andrews earned a bachelor’s degree in systems engineering from the United States Naval Academy and an MBA from the Kellogg School of Management at Northwestern University.
